Prestwick Airport annual accounts show a record 6th year in profit and the Ayrshire airport is well on its way to a 7th
Prestwick airport annual account figures have been released. An outstanding 6th year of profit is reported, and we are told it is also being followed with record flight and income increases in 2025. Doug Maclean Aviation Editor. Prestwick’s continuing success has come after it is revealed that the airport was able to invest £10 million of its own money into development which is paying off handsomely. Christmas is on his way and Santa’s helpers are busy at work
By Aviation Editor Doug Maclean. It’s a sight we have never seen before. A China Southern Boeing 777 freighter has just offloaded its 110 tonnes of cargo from Guangzhou, Southern China. The thousands of parcels will be delivered to households all over the UK in the next couple of days. Meanwhile an Air China Boeing 777 lands with another 110 tonnes of presents from Beijing. Boeing V22 US Air Force Ospreys Visit Prestwick Airport
Quite a few people were asking what on earth laded at Prestwick just as it was getting dark ? The answer is 2 Boeing V22 Ospreys belonging to the United States Air Force. Aviation Editor Doug Maclean. They are big, powerful and heavy. The Osprey is 57 feet long and powered by 2 Rolls Royce jet engines. Profitable Prestwick Airport Will Not Be Privatised This Year
Business as usual as airport wings its way to another profitable year. Aviation Editor Doug Maclean - 27 th November 2025 Prestwick airport is shortly to report it’s annual accounts to the Scottish Parliament. Last year the airport reported a historic 5 th year in profit.
